Address 0 PPC

P8oWk31h1qiLbzEvnn7ifycRU141gYey86

Confirmed

Total Received41.296603 PPC
Total Sent41.296603 PPC
Final Balance0 PPC
No. Transactions2

Transactions

P8oWk31h1qiLbzEvnn7ifycRU141gYey8641.296603 PPC
Fee: 0.00225 PPC
143701 Confirmations41.294353 PPC
P8oWk31h1qiLbzEvnn7ifycRU141gYey8641.296603 PPC
PJA4J4urvJED9ycu4khjztxYS7Z2BvLsZY1.501487 PPC
Fee: 0.00191 PPC
143718 Confirmations42.79809 PPC